First off, let's talk about college applications. We all know the struggle. A killer GPA? Check. Sizzling SAT scores? Hopefully. But what really makes your application stand out from the crowd? That's right, my friends – extracurriculars. They showcase your passions, your skills, and your commitment outside of academics. Think of it as showing colleges the real you, not just the test-taking machine.
But it's not just about getting into college. Extracurriculars are a total game-changer for your personal growth. I mean, how else are you going to discover hidden talents? Maybe you're a natural leader, a coding whiz, or a surprisingly amazing artist. You never know until you try!
And let's not forget the social aspect. I've met some of my closest friends through extracurriculars. It's a chance to connect with people who share your interests, build teamwork skills, and learn how to navigate group dynamics. You know, those essential life skills they don't exactly teach in math class.
Plus, extracurriculars can seriously boost your resume. Imagine impressing a potential employer with your experience as captain of the debate team or president of the robotics club. It shows initiative, dedication, and the ability to juggle multiple responsibilities – all super valuable in the workplace.
